Abstract

Nanocrystalline mixtures of Nd2Fe14B and a-Fe have been synthesized by mechanical milling and heat treatment. The samples exhibit isotropic behavior, with significant remanence enhancement associated with exchange coupling across the interfaces of hard and soft magnetic phases. Measurements of the effect of heat treatment on structure and magnetic behavior demonstrate the important influence of grain size on magnetic properties. The effect of alloy additions to increase the saturation magnetization of the soft phase and the magnetocrystalline anisotropy of the hard phase has also been investigated.
